对象存储服务怎样用数据库,深入浅出,对象存储服务应用详解及实战指南
- 综合资讯
- 2024-11-30 00:56:58
- 1

对象存储服务结合数据库应用,本指南深入浅出讲解对象存储服务原理,应用场景及实战技巧。涵盖数据管理、安全性和优化策略,助您高效利用对象存储服务。...
对象存储服务结合数据库应用,本指南深入浅出讲解对象存储服务原理,应用场景及实战技巧。涵盖数据管理、安全性和优化策略,助您高效利用对象存储服务。
随着互联网的快速发展,数据量呈爆炸式增长,传统的文件存储方式已无法满足日益增长的数据存储需求,对象存储服务(Object Storage Service,OSS)作为一种新兴的存储技术,凭借其海量存储、弹性伸缩、安全可靠等特点,已成为各大企业、机构存储数据的首选,本文将深入浅出地介绍对象存储服务的基本概念、应用场景以及如何使用对象存储服务。
对象存储服务概述
1、什么是对象存储服务?
对象存储服务是一种基于云的存储服务,它将数据以对象的形式存储,每个对象包含数据、元数据以及唯一标识符,对象存储服务具有以下特点:
(1)海量存储:对象存储服务支持PB级别的存储空间,可满足大规模数据存储需求。
(2)弹性伸缩:根据实际需求自动调整存储空间,实现按需付费。
(3)安全可靠:采用多级数据冗余机制,确保数据安全。
(4)简单易用:无需复杂配置,用户可轻松管理存储资源。
2、对象存储服务应用场景
(1)大数据存储:对象存储服务适用于大规模数据存储,如海量图片、视频、文档等。
(2)云应用开发:为云应用提供存储支持,如云游戏、云视频等。
(3)数据备份与归档:实现数据备份、归档和恢复,提高数据安全性。
(4)企业内部存储:为企业内部数据提供安全、高效的存储解决方案。
对象存储服务使用指南
1、选择合适的对象存储服务提供商
目前市场上主流的对象存储服务提供商有阿里云OSS、腾讯云COS、华为云OBS等,在选择对象存储服务提供商时,应考虑以下因素:
(1)价格:比较不同提供商的价格,选择性价比高的服务。
(2)性能:了解不同提供商的读写性能、网络带宽等指标。
(3)地域:根据业务需求选择合适的地理位置,降低数据传输延迟。
(4)生态:考虑提供商的合作伙伴、SDK、API等生态资源。
2、创建对象存储服务账号
在选择的提供商平台上,注册并创建一个账号,根据平台要求,完成实名认证等操作。
3、创建存储空间(Bucket)
在账号中创建一个存储空间,相当于本地文件系统中的文件夹,存储空间是存储对象的基本单元。
4、上传对象
将需要存储的数据上传到存储空间中,可以通过以下方式上传对象:
(1)Web控制台:在提供商平台的控制台中,上传文件到存储空间。
(2)API:通过编程方式,使用SDK或直接调用API上传对象。
(3)命令行工具:使用如ossutil、coscmd等命令行工具上传对象。
5、访问对象
上传对象后,可以通过以下方式访问:
(1)URL:通过对象存储服务的URL直接访问对象。
(2)SDK:使用提供商提供的SDK,通过编程方式访问对象。
(3)API:直接调用API访问对象。
6、权限管理
为确保数据安全,需要合理设置对象存储服务的权限,以下是一些常见的权限设置方法:
(1)Bucket策略:为存储空间设置访问权限,包括读写、删除等操作。
(2)CORS策略:允许或拒绝跨域请求,保护数据安全。
(3)访问密钥:为用户提供访问权限,实现细粒度控制。
对象存储服务作为一种新兴的存储技术,在数据存储领域具有广泛应用前景,本文从基本概念、应用场景以及使用指南等方面,详细介绍了对象存储服务,希望对您了解和使用对象存储服务有所帮助,在实际应用中,根据业务需求选择合适的对象存储服务提供商,合理配置存储空间、对象以及权限,实现高效、安全的数据存储。
本文链接:https://zhitaoyun.cn/1198172.html
发表评论